5 medical students will be climbing the national three peaks in 24 hours raising money for the Shelo Orphanage Foundation.
Fundraising pageThe Shelo Orphanage Foundation is a charity set up and run by medical students to support children orphaned by AIDs in eastern Uganda. We provide shelter, and education to 300 vulnerable children, and with further support we are hoping to commence a community nutrition initiative.
